body { padding: 20px; background-position: left top; text-align: left; color: #000; background: #fff;}

.forms { font-size: 80%; font-family: Arial, Helvetica, sans-serif; }
.forms h1, .forms h2, .forms p {  margin: 0 0 10px; }
.forms h1 { color: #B6C25A; }

.forms form#email_page div.formRow p { margin-bottom: 0;  }
.forms form#email_page div.formRow p span.required {  }

.forms form#email_page div {/*border: 1px solid #000;*/ float: left; width: 100%; }
.forms form#email_page div.formRow { margin-bottom: 10px; }
.forms form#email_page div.formRowSubmit { }

.forms form#email_page span.required { font-weight: bold; color: #97A813; padding-left: 5px; }
.forms form#email_page span.note{  }

.forms form#email_page label { display: block; empty-cells: show; width: 160px; float: left; margin-bottom: 5px; }

.forms form#email_page input, .forms form#email_page textarea { margin: 0; padding: 2px; color: #97A813; }
.forms form#email_page input {  float: left; width: 240px; font-size: 90%; }
.forms form#email_page textarea {  height: 80px; width: 400px; }

.forms form#email_page input.button { margin-right: 10px; width: auto; float: left; clear: none; border: 1px solid #B6C25A; background: #97A813; color: #fff; }

